Raspberry Sea Heuchera
Heuchera 'Raspberry Sea'
SKU
34572
Raspberry pink, maple-shaped foliage forms a colorful, compact mound. Sprays of light pink flowers emerge above the foliage in late spring to early summer. A wonderful choice to add contrast to mixed containers, borders, and woodlands.

Provide enriched, well-drained soil; take care not to bury crown when planting. Prefers part shade in hot summer areas. Water deeply, regularly in first growing season to establish extensive root system; reduce frequency once established. Avoid excess winter moisture. Feed throughout growing season. Remove old, faded foliage in early spring.
